Ask a questionCTGF levels can be measured using various techniques, including enzyme-linked immunosorbent assay (ELISA) and immunohistochemistry.
CTGF levels can serve as diagnostic markers for fibrotic diseases, aiding in the early detection and monitoring of such conditions.
Yes, targeting CTGF is being explored as a potential therapeutic strategy to mitigate fibrosis in various organs and tissues.
CTGF protein research is particularly relevant in specialties such as rheumatology, pulmonology, and dermatology due to its implications in fibrotic diseases.
CTGF plays a crucial role in promoting the formation of fibrous tissue by stimulating the production of extracellular matrix proteins.
